May Day 2017: All the Memes You Need to See

“It’s gonna be May!” May 1 is a day of many celebrations, from the pagan holiday of Beltane to International Workers’ Day, or Labour Day, and Loyalty Day in the United States. It’s also the day of Justin Timberlake memes.

Easter 2017: All the Memes You Need to See

Happy Easter! Today Christians everywhere are celebrating the resurrection of Jesus Christ with Easter egg hunts, Easter bunnies, and more. Here are some funny memes about this holiday.

Jeff Sessions & Russia: All the Memes You Need to See

Jeff Sessions, Attorney General of the United States under President Donald Trump, is under scrutiny after it was revealed that he met with Russian Ambassador Sergey Kislyak twice last year, which he did not disclose.